Not at all. In fact, those cases will ONLY be found by contact tracing. Mildly ill persons don't normally get tested. However, some of the people infected by the mildly ill persons will get ill enough to be tested. The person who is ill will name the mildly ill person as a "close contact". That will cause two things to happen. First, the mildly sick person will be quarantined, period. They will not infect anybody else. Big win. Second, that mildly ill person will be tested and return a positive result. The "close contacts" of the mildly ill person will then be quarantined, preventing any spread from those people who are not yet sick. It is important to realize that we do have one thing going in our favor with this virus. We have a test. If you are contagious, you will test positive with high probability. That allows the second part of the operation above to work. Without a test, it is probably impossible to justify quarantine of "close contacts once removed". Tracking and tracing would still work, just not quite as well.

Exactly.
Remember, the R0 of the virus is estimated at between 2 and 3, so absent any intervention, on average each infected person will infect 2 to 3 susceptible people. If R is > 1, the epidemic will increase exponentially; if R < 1 the epidemic will decrease and peter out. Because of social distancing, right now R is somewhere in the 1 to 1.5 range in the US. That means that cases are growing, slowly. In order to "win" you don't have to stop all remaining infections; you just have to stop enough of them to get drive R to below 1.
So, let's say that on average 50% of patients are symptomatic. You find a symptomatic patient, and trace both forwards and backwards. If you alert and test most of that person's contacts, you should be able to catch all the symptomatic patients early (since now they are primed to look for symptoms and assume that their mild cough is actually COVID-19 and not their allergies), and you might catch the asymptomatic patients if you test them at the right time. Even if you don't catch their asymptomatic contact, by telling them they've been exposed and to quarantine, even if it is not perfect, you can probably reduce their close personal contacts by 50%, enough to drive R to below 1. You also trace backwards, and hopefully identify the person who infected them, who should test positive (symptomatic or not). That will let you test all that patient's contacts.
Yes, the system won't be perfect. But it doesn't have to be perfect as long as 1) there are reasonable measures to reduce transmission (social distancing protocols, mask wearing, etc.) and 2) you interrupt enough chains of transmission to drive R to below 1. If you do all that, infections will go down over time (which incidentally makes your job easier).

No, it isn't even that hard. It is much more like garbage collection. It is well understood, totally necessary, and requires a significant but not gigantic staff to do the work.
Take San Mateo County as an example. They say they are currently doing it with a staff of about 100 people. The 14 day moving average is currently 28 cases a day. If each case had 10 close contacts (a very high number), that would be a steady-state of 280 people to contact in a day. A staff of 25 could undoubtedly do that, and they have more than that. LA County is another story. That is why the SIP getting the case load down was initially required. Unfortunately, in some places that didn't work so well and those places did not staff up to track and trace. As demonstrated above, they could have. It isn't all that hard. They just didn't do it. Different problem.
Just as an aside, quarantining 280 people every day for a two week period would result in 3920 people or 0.5% of the population being in quarantine (steady state). Easily tolerated. It would be "normal" that that rate would actually drop to zero pretty fast.

Since it is hard to know exactly when someone was exposed and there is a fair bit of uncertainty around the incubation period, when you contact trace close contacts you are testing both prospective and retrospective contacts simultaneously, as long as you use a broad enough time period. Retrospective contact tracing is harder, because you generally have to trace further back in time, and memories fade.
So you are right, you are mostly going to catch prospective contacts. But that doesn't mean you don't try. It's not about having to be perfect, but the more transmission chains you intercept, the further you drive down R, and the faster you drive down the burden of disease.

I still believe that the rapid and heavily used jet travel is in fact the driving force for the extent of this epidemic. How many people traveled from Wuhan to the USA in 1960? How many people from Wuhan would even consider traveling to Germany for a 3 day meeting in 1960? The answers are almost none and none. It isn't just that the delay from outbreak in China to COVID-19 positive people arriving in the USA was greatly reduced. That is bad enough, and cuts the reaction time way down. Worse still are two other factors.
First, the number of positive people arriving in the USA was much, much larger than would have been the case before jet travel became available, relatively cheap, and heavily relied upon in daily life. In point of fact, about twice as many people visit the the USA each month as were in the entire AEF in WW I. This does not include Americans returning home from travel. There is no way to manage such an influx to exclude positive people. The resulting influx creates an "instant epidemic". Just like hospital ICUs, epidemic response teams can be overwhelmed by sheer numbers. In the past, we had exponential spread from a few patients. A small tracking and tracing organization could cope. When you have a flood of people burrowing into the population that is positive for COVID-19, there is no chance to contain it and many cases of exponential spread are inevitable. Thus the extent in the USA. SIP becomes the only possible response.
Second, the "direction" from which the epidemic arrives is no longer predictable. The bad situation in New York/New Jersey was generated not by visitors from China, but rather people returning from Europe. In the past, the public health people could ask "Were you in China on this trip?" If you said no, they let you through, knowing you were probably not positive. However, many people got exposed in other nations at a time when those nations were not real hotbeds of disease. This is possible because easy travel allows people from anywhere to mix with people from anywhere, not just with "natives" of a given destination. International conferences are common today. Perfect spreading events. Before easy, fast jet travel such events were rare.
So yes, I think the travel climate made things much, much worse than they would have been in "the past". Not that I am trying to advocate going back in time. Rather, I am advocating recognizing that it is a new ball game and reacting accordingly.

I'm not sure what you mean here. We have dramatically flattened the curve. Even in states where there is an increase in cases, R is on the order of 1.2 - 1.4, not as high as the R0 of 2.5 - 3. That means that while the number of cases are increasing, they aren't increasing as fast it would have in the absence of measures. And we reducing the restrictions. I think in an ideal world, you titrate the restrictions to ensure R is slightly less than 1, loosening them as long as case counts are declining and tightening them as case counts start to climb.
I think Europe is (generally) a good case study. I posted a plot of the number of cases in Europe versus the United States post peak, and you could see that the number of cases in Europe dropped dramatically compared to the US. In most places (excepting Sweden), the lockdowns were harsher and more dramatic than in the US. And you can draw a direct line from that to declining number of deaths and cases. As a consequence, they are also able to relax their lockdowns more aggressively. The benefits of the lockdown are immediately apparent to most Europeans. The US is caught in a bit of a purgatory. We are locked down enough to cause economic pain and provoke a backlash, but not effectively enough to prevent cases from rising in a bunch of places.
Perhaps that is the source of your frustration. But I can assure you that things would almost certainly be worse in a world where there were no restrictions whatsoever. We have seen that story play out: Italy, Spain, New York prior to lockdowns, Brazil and Mexico now. While things aren't looking great in Florida, Texas, Arizona, California and a few other places, we still aren't talking about things spiraling out of control.
